A Gigawatt (GW) is a unit of power equal to one billion watts ( W) or 1,000 megawatts.
It represents a significant amount of energy. To visualize this scale, a single gigawatt is roughly the amount of power generated by one large nuclear power plant.
This level of power is sufficient to supply electricity to hundreds of thousands of homes simultaneously.
The gigawatt is a standard unit for measuring the output of large-scale power generation facilities and national energy grids.

The term "gigawatt" gained widespread recognition through the classic 1985 film Back to the Future.
The iconic line "1.21 gigawatts!," delivered by Dr. Emmett Brown, refers to the immense power needed for the DeLorean time machine.
While often mispronounced as "jigowatt" in the movie, this famous quote introduced a massive audience to this unit of electrical power, cementing its place in popular culture.
Metric horsepower, often abbreviated as PS, is a common unit used to measure the power of an engine, especially for cars and motorcycles from Europe and Asia.
If you have ever looked at car specifications from a German or Japanese brand, you have likely seen this term.
Defined within the metric system, it is the power needed to lift a 75-kilogram mass one meter vertically in one second.
In more technical terms, one metric horsepower is precisely equal to 735.49875 watts (W). This standard is essential for accurately comparing the power of different engines, particularly when dealing with international vehicle specifications.
The abbreviation "PS" comes from the German word Pferdestärke, which literally translates to "horse strength" or horsepower.
This term originated in 19th-century Germany and quickly became the standard for measuring automotive power across much of Europe and Asia. Its widespread adoption reflects the metric system's dominance in those regions for scientific and industrial measurements.
While they sound almost identical, metric horsepower (PS) is not the same as the mechanical horsepower (hp) commonly used in the United States and the UK.
The key difference lies in their wattage equivalent. This small but important distinction is critical when you want to compare vehicle performance specifications from different markets accurately.
For example, a car advertised with 200 PS has slightly less power than a car advertised with 200 hp.
Here's a simple breakdown of the differences:
| Feature | Metric Horsepower (PS) | Mechanical Horsepower (hp) |
|---|---|---|
| Commonly Used In | Europe, Asia | United States, UK |
| Wattage Equivalent | ~735.5 W | ~745.7 W |
| Relation to Each Other | 1 PS ≈ 0.986 hp | 1 hp ≈ 1.014 PS |
